Kittenblock畫筆基礎(chǔ)教程:從跟蹤鼠標(biāo)到移動(dòng)留下痕跡的蝴蝶
畫筆實(shí)例解讀Kittenblock是一款適合初學(xué)者的編程軟件,通過(guò)圖形化編程的方式幫助用戶輕松上手。在本教程中,我們將學(xué)習(xí)如何使用Kittenblock的畫筆功能實(shí)現(xiàn)一個(gè)有趣的效果:讓角色跟蹤鼠標(biāo)移
畫筆實(shí)例解讀
Kittenblock是一款適合初學(xué)者的編程軟件,通過(guò)圖形化編程的方式幫助用戶輕松上手。在本教程中,我們將學(xué)習(xí)如何使用Kittenblock的畫筆功能實(shí)現(xiàn)一個(gè)有趣的效果:讓角色跟蹤鼠標(biāo)移動(dòng)并在舞臺(tái)上留下痕跡,就像蝴蝶飛舞一般。
跟蹤鼠標(biāo),畫筆落筆
首先,我們需要啟動(dòng)Kittenblock軟件,并按照指示導(dǎo)入所需模塊和設(shè)置變量。接著,制作背景并將其轉(zhuǎn)換為矢量圖,這將為后續(xù)操作鋪平道路。然后添加角色并調(diào)整其屬性,確保角色能夠自由移動(dòng)。
循環(huán)語(yǔ)句與移動(dòng)語(yǔ)句
接下來(lái),我們將調(diào)用事件模塊來(lái)觸發(fā)程序執(zhí)行的邏輯。通過(guò)調(diào)用畫筆模塊,我們可以控制畫筆的落筆和擦除動(dòng)作,讓角色在移動(dòng)時(shí)在舞臺(tái)上留下痕跡。利用控制模塊的循環(huán)功能,使程序能夠重復(fù)執(zhí)行一系列操作,實(shí)現(xiàn)連續(xù)的畫筆軌跡效果。
畫筆顏色設(shè)置與角色移動(dòng)
在編寫程序時(shí),我們還可以調(diào)用運(yùn)動(dòng)模塊來(lái)設(shè)置角色的移動(dòng)方式,例如每次移動(dòng)5步。當(dāng)角色碰到舞臺(tái)邊緣時(shí),可以讓其反彈,增加程序的趣味性。此外,我們可以通過(guò)設(shè)定畫筆顏色和粗細(xì)參數(shù),讓畫筆的痕跡更加豐富多彩。
Scratch3.0(.sb3)與Python應(yīng)用
Kittenblock提供了與Scratch3.0(.sb3)和Python的兼容性,用戶可以根據(jù)自己的喜好選擇編程語(yǔ)言。無(wú)論是初學(xué)者還是有一定編程基礎(chǔ)的用戶,使用Kittenblock都能夠快速上手,并享受編程帶來(lái)的樂趣。
測(cè)試效果與總結(jié)
最后,在完成編寫程序后,我們可以讓角色移動(dòng)2步并面向鼠標(biāo)指針,實(shí)現(xiàn)跟蹤鼠標(biāo)的效果。通過(guò)舞臺(tái)測(cè)試,我們可以看到角色在移動(dòng)過(guò)程中留下的畫筆痕跡,仿佛一只蝴蝶在舞蹈。Kittenblock的畫筆基礎(chǔ)教程為我們展示了如何利用簡(jiǎn)單的代碼實(shí)現(xiàn)有趣的交互效果,希望本教程能夠幫助讀者更好地理解Kittenblock的應(yīng)用與原理。